
The AirTAC Airtac SAIF Series Standard Cylinder with Valve SAIF40X50S-06F is a genuine double-acting ISO 15552 cylinder with a Ø40mm bore, 50mm stroke and a built-in 4M210-06 5/2 solenoid valve — it switches itself from one coil signal, so no separate remote valve or extra plumbing is needed.
The AirTAC SAIF40X50S-06F is a double-acting ISO 15552 profile cylinder equipped with a built-in 4M210-06 5/2 solenoid valve, delivering a 14.0 mm2 flow (Cv 0.78). Driven by a DC12V terminal entry coil drawing 3.0 W, it integrates switching directly onto the actuator. The cylinder body features a carbon steel piston rod and a magnetic piston (-S) for precise position detection using CMSE reed or DMSE electronic sensors.
While the bare cylinder rates to 1.0 MPa, the practical operating range for this valved assembly is 0.15-0.8 MPa. The manifold connects the valve to the cylinder via an O8xO5 PU tube, and the valve port (1/8") differs from the cylinder port (1/4"). Factory-set to retract when energized, the valve can be repositioned to extend on signal, offering self-contained decentralized control without remote plumbing.

SAIF does not hold its load without air — the valve routes air, it is not a lock. For load-holding use a SAIL (lock) or BSAI (clamp-lock).

Choose this 40mm bore when you need 628N push force at 0.5 MPa, stepping up from the 32mm class (402N) for heavier loads, or down from the 50mm class (982N) to save space. The self-valved SAIF design eliminates separate remote valves and long tubing runs, making it ideal for decentralized stations where panel space is tight. It operates at 30-800 mm/s.
This model uses a DC12V terminal coil with PT tapered threads. If your application requires holding the load mechanically without live air pressure, note that the 5/2 valve and air cushions only route air and decelerate motion; they do not lock the rod. For secure clamping, consider the SAIL lock variant. When replacing, match the 40mm bore, 50mm stroke, 1/8" valve port, DC12V voltage, terminal entry, and -S magnet.
